Abstract

ABSTRACTPoetry always has a unique charm that captivates and draws the reader into its figurative world. One of the most interesting charm is symbolism used by the poet, in one single word lays a deeper explanation beyond what is perceptible by the eyes. Therefore, the aim of this research was to reveal the symbolism in “The Haunted Palace”, a gothic-themed poetry written by a well-known poet Sir Edgar Allan Poe. Having analyzed this poetry, the writer later found that Poe’s “The Haunted Palace” has some unique symbols used by the poet himself. Despite of writing long and descriptive lines, the poet chose appropriate symbols that lead the readers to think and conjecturing more deeply. Every symbol used in “The Haunted Palace” represents simplicity, authenticity and brilliancy of Poe himself. Thus, a symbolism holds a very important role of poetry. It is not only pleasantly presented but also elucidating things beyond its literal substance. It proves that Poe’s “The Haunted Palace” is pleasant to be read but difficult to be interpreted.Keywords: poetry, symbolism, The Haunted Palace, Edgar Allan Poe

Abstract

ABSTRACT The aim of this study is to observe students’ Adversity Quotient and their Academic Performance, in this case English subject. From many previous studies, there is a high indication that Adversity Quotient plays an important role in students’ academic performance. Therefore, this study was carried out to observe that hypothesis. Quantitative method was used wherefore the data was in form of numbers, namely from Adversity Quotient test and students’ final grade in English class. The findings showed that majority of the students who exceled in academic performance were the students whose test results showed that they were classified with high level of Adversity Quotient. Furthermore, as this study included 2 groups of students, the data depicted that the adult students performed a better result in AQ test than the fresh graduate students who were both in the same semester.
